Transaction 61573396df0f4bca0017162009ca55a1b93c021d274ef61f66d898d8a85da3cb
1 Input
1 Output
-
61573396df0f4bca0017162009ca55a1b93c021d274ef61f66d898d8a85da3cb:0
- value
- 124066
- script pubkey
- OP_0 OP_PUSHBYTES_20 285b856b2d8654b726f4e6991ed045afdee30d38
- address
- bc1q9pdc26edse2twfh5u6v3a5z94l0wxrfcka2fng